Sowbridge Branch (Primehook Creek tributary)

Sowbridge Branch is a 5.44 mi (8.75 km) long 2nd order tributary to Primehook Creek in Sussex County, Delaware.
Remove ads
Variant names
According to the Geographic Names Information System, it has also been known historically as:[1]
- Sawbridge Branch
- Sow Bridge Branch
Course
Sowbridge Branch rises on the Gravelly Branch divide about 0.5 miles southeast of Ellendale, Delaware. Sowbridge Branch then flows generally east to meet Primehook Creek at Waples Pond.[2]
Watershed
Sowbridge Branch drains 7.86 square miles (20.4 km2) of area, receives about 45.4 in/year of precipitation, has a topographic wetness index of 649.54 and is about 19% forested.[4]
